What is the current market overview of the North America Artificial Joints Market?

The North America Artificial Joints Market is a critical segment of the orthopedic medical device sector, valued at 10.09 Billion in 2026. It encompasses the design, manufacturing, and distribution of prosthetic replacements for knee, hip, and shoulder joints. This market is defined by rigorous FDA oversight and significant technological integration, serving an aging population that increasingly demands higher mobility standards and long-term implant durability.

Structural Growth Drivers and Market Constraints

The primary catalyst for growth is the rising incidence of osteoarthritis among the elderly, which creates sustained demand for joint replacement. Conversely, high regulatory hurdles and the logistical complexity of specialized supply chains present significant challenges. Opportunities exist in Ambulatory Care Centers, where shifted surgical volume creates a more cost-effective ecosystem for providers, effectively balancing the high price-points of premium Ceramics and Oxinium based implants.

Emerging Trends in Orthopedic Reconstruction

Industry research highlights a decisive shift toward outpatient procedures and personalized medicine. Technologies such as patient-specific instrumentation and 3D-printed metal alloys are gaining traction, allowing surgeons to improve implant fit. Furthermore, the integration of data analytics into perioperative care is revolutionizing patient outcomes, ensuring that manufacturers like Stryker Corporation and Zimmer Biomet maintain their competitive edge by offering more than just hardware.

Porter's Five Forces Assessment

The competitive environment is defined by intense rivalry among established giants, while the threat of new entrants remains low due to strict regulatory entry barriers. Buyer power is increasing as hospitals consolidate, exerting pressure on price. However, supplier power is moderated by the standardized nature of Alloys and other raw materials, leaving technical innovation as the primary lever for competitive advantage.

Value Chain Analysis from Raw Materials to End-Users

The value chain originates with the sourcing of medical-grade Alloys and Ceramics, followed by highly regulated manufacturing processes. Distributors move these finished joints through established logistical networks to hospitals and ambulatory centers. The final phase involves the surgical implantation by orthopedic specialists, where value is captured through clinical efficacy and patient longevity, driving repeat demand and brand loyalty.
